01 / What this service is

What this service is

End-to-end product development for projects that span multiple disciplines — a connected device that needs PCB + firmware + enclosure + web dashboard, all delivered as one.

One scope, not four

Requirements agreed once across all disciplines — no conflicting briefs between vendors.

Coordinated delivery

PCB, firmware, enclosure, and software handovers timed together — not thrown over separate walls.

Single point of contact

You manage one relationship, not four. We flag cross-discipline risks before they become your problem.
